Exploring the Secrets of 4D Spacetime

Delving into the realm beyond 4-dimensional spacetime is a complex endeavor, stretching our conceptual understanding about the universe. As we perceive three spatial dimensions with relative ease, visualizing a fourth dimension poses a unprecedented challenge. Physicists are continuously working to illuminate the mysteries of this extra plane, leveraging complex mathematical models and cutting-edge observational techniques.

  • A key theory in 4D spacetime is a connection between space and time. Einstein's theory of relativity postulates that these two are not separate entities but create a unified whole called spacetime.
  • Additionally, the fourth dimension is often depicted as being at right angles to our three spatial dimensions. However, picturing such a dimension can be quite complex for the human mind.

Our quest to understand 4D spacetime remains as a fascinating journey, driving the boundaries of 4D our cognitive knowledge and broadening our insight into the grand tapestry of the universe.
